Abstract

The invention discloses a kind of anti-dropout infusion device syringe needle, including syringe needle for transfusion device and anti-dropout elastic covering, syringe needle for transfusion device upper end has fixed block, and the anti-dropout elasticity enclosure is in syringe needle for transfusion device, and upper end is fixed on fixed block;When the present invention is strutted by anti-dropout elastic covering, syringe needle for transfusion device cannot fall off, and when anti-dropout elastic covering is closed, medical staff is extracted.The present invention effectively can avoid syringe needle for transfusion device from surprisingly falling off, and prevent children or the dry dynamic patient of stupor from extracting syringe needle for transfusion device;Avoid drug or blood loss;Prevent pollution environment;Caused by avoiding medical staff from falling off because of syringe needle workload increase and avoid patient or family members therefore caused by scaring and worry;Reduce health resources waste;It reduces the generation of medical treatment and nursing accident and reduces infusion cost.

Description

A kind of anti-syringe needle dropping device of infusion apparatus
Technical field
The present invention relates to medical field, in particular to a kind of anti-syringe needle dropping device of infusion apparatus.
Background technique
Infusion is that into intracorporal large dosage, (single administration is packaged in 50ml or more) injection by intravenous drip In glass or plastic infusion bottle or bag, preservative or bacteriostatic agent are free of, it is lasting and even by infusion apparatus adjustment drop speed when use Enter vein, provides nutriment, blood and product supplement colloid and blood volume to supplement body fluid, electrolyte etc..Infusion In the process, it is not intended to know patient or children drag infusion apparatus sometimes, since infusion apparatus front end syringe needle is smooth, it is easy to fall off, make At drug or blood loss, pollution environment, the workload for increasing medical staff, especially patient or family members is made to get a fright, increase Patient fluid infusion's cost, and existing infusion apparatus tip infusion hole is too top, and residual liquid is relatively more in infusion bottle, for as youngster It is insufficient to will cause drug input quantity for the less patient of section's special defects patient fluids' input quantity, some specific drugs are expensive, make At waste, increase cost, reduces drug effect.
Summary of the invention
The invention aims to solve in above-mentioned background technique, existing infusion apparatus front end syringe needle is smooth, it is easy to it falls off, It causes drug or blood loss, pollution environment, the workload for increasing medical staff, especially patient or family members made to get a fright, increase Add patient fluid infusion's cost, and existing infusion apparatus tip infusion hole is too top, residual liquid is relatively more in infusion bottle, for picture It is insufficient to will cause drug input quantity for the less patient of paediatrics special defects patient fluids' input quantity, some specific drugs are expensive, The problems such as causing waste, increasing cost, reduce drug effect, and a kind of anti-syringe needle dropping device of infusion apparatus is provided.
A kind of anti-dropout infusion device syringe needle, including syringe needle for transfusion device and anti-dropout elastic covering, syringe needle for transfusion device upper end have Fixed block, the anti-dropout elasticity enclosure is in syringe needle for transfusion device, and upper end is fixed on fixed block;
The syringe needle for transfusion device lower end has leakproof elastic washer, and leakproof elastic washer outer wall is sealed with elastic covering is fallen Cooperation;
The syringe needle for transfusion device lower end is respectively provided with the first infusion hole, the second infusion hole, the first elastic rod, the second elasticity Bar, annular groove, the first rectangle sliding slot and the second rectangle sliding slot, the first elastic rod and the second elastic rod structure are identical, and first is defeated Fluid apertures and the second infusion pore size distribution setting are in syringe needle for transfusion device lower end, and leakproof elastic washer is arranged in annular groove, the first bullet Property bar be arranged in the first rectangle sliding slot, the second elastic rod be arranged in the second rectangle sliding slot;
The elastic rod upper/lower terminal is respectively provided with button and fixture block;
Anti-dropout elastic covering upper end is provided with through-hole, and centre has several anti-flakes of elasticity, and lower end has push jack, pushes away Piece lower end has card slot;
The through-hole is arranged on fixed block;
The fixture block is matched with card slot.
The working principle of the invention and process:
Original state, anti-dropout elastic covering are not switched on, several anti-flakes of elasticity on anti-dropout elastic covering are vertical state, Medical staff first by present invention insertion infusion bottle, pushes push jack then up and withstands on infusion bag lower end, in the process, prevent The elastic covering upper end that falls off is fixed, and lower part moves up, effect of several the anti-flakes of elasticity on anti-dropout elastic covering in extruding force Under heave, increase diameter of the infusion apparatus inside bottle body, syringe needle for transfusion device made to be not easy to fall off from infusion bottle or transfer to, anti- Elastic covering lower part fall off when move up, when being moved to certain position, the card slot on anti-dropout elastic covering and are set Fixture block contact on one elastic rod, fixture block stick into card slot, keep several anti-flakes of elasticity to heave, prevent from falling off, be arranged in ring Leakproof elastic washer in connected in star shuts the gap among anti-dropout elastic covering and syringe needle for transfusion device, prevents the medicine in infusion Liquid prolongs the outflow of the gap among anti-dropout elastic covering and syringe needle for transfusion device.
After the completion of infusion, medical staff pins button, and card slot and fixture block are detached from, the effect of anti-dropout elastic covering screen resilience Lower reinstatement, lantern-shaped structure disappear, can extract infusion apparatus.
Beneficial effects of the present invention:
The present invention effectively can avoid syringe needle for transfusion device from surprisingly falling off, and prevent children or the dry dynamic patient of stupor by infusion apparatus needle Head is extracted;Avoid drug or blood loss;Prevent pollution environment;Workload increases caused by avoiding medical staff from falling off because of syringe needle Adduction avoid patient or family members therefore caused by scaring and worry;Reduce health resources waste;Reduce medical treatment and nursing accident Occur and reduce infusion cost.
